Classic Macaroni Salad

Add the eggs, celery, red bell pepper, red onion and sweet pickles. In a small bowl, mix the mayonnaise, pickle juice, sugar, and Dijon mustard; season with k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per. Add to the macaroni and toss until evenly coated. Season with more salt and pepper to taste then refrigerate for 1 hour before serving.

THE BEST Classic Macaroni Salad

Gather all ingredients. Bring a large pot of lightly salted water to a boil. Cook elbow macaroni in the boiling water, stirring occasionally, until tender yet firm to the bite, about 8 minutes. Rinse under cold water and drain. Mix mayonnaise, sugar, vinegar, mustard, salt, pepper, and macaroni together in a large bowl.

Mom's Classic Macaroni Salad Lord Byron's Kitchen

While the pasta is cooking, combine the dressing ingredients in a small bowl. Mix well. In a large bowl, add the cooled macaroni, the dressing, celery, carrots, red pepper, and onion. Mix well. Taste and add additional salt and pepper if desired. Refrigerate the macaroni salad for at least 1 to 2 hours before serving.
